What is Extended Reality (XR):
Extended reality (XR) is an umbrella term that encompasses a range of immersive technologies that merge the physical and digital worlds. It includes virtual reality (VR), which creates a completely virtual environment; Augmented Reality (AR), which overlays digital objects onto the real world; and Mixed Reality (MR), which combines elements of both. These technologies use various hardware like headsets, sensors, and smartphones, along with software applications, to create interactive experiences. XR has applications across diverse sectors such as healthcare, education, entertainment, and manufacturing. It can be used for training simulations, remote collaboration, data visualization, and enhanced customer experiences, among other applications.

Extended Reality (XR) Market Trends:
Significant technological innovation represents one of the key factors driving the growth of the market across the globe. Advances in hardware, such as lighter and more comfortable headsets, and software, including more realistic rendering and improved user interfaces, are making XR experiences increasingly compelling. As awareness and understanding of XR technologies grow, so does the appetite for enhanced experiences in gaming, entertainment, and social interaction.
The market for consumer-oriented XR applications is expanding rapidly, fueled by this demand. In the enterprise sector, XR is seen as a tool for increasing efficiency and reducing costs. Whether it’s training employees in a virtual environment or helping designers and engineers visualize a product before it’s built, XR applications are finding their way into various industries, including healthcare, education, and manufacturing. The rise of remote work and collaboration tools, accelerated by global events like the COVID-19 pandemic, is also acting as a major growth-inducing factor. Other factors, such as investment and funding in XR technologies, and regulatory support are creating a positive outlook for the market across the globe.
